What is the best way to fix a dent in a wooden floor?
Denting in wooden floors can be a frustrating experience for homeowners. Wooden floors add beauty and warmth to any space, but they are not immune to damage. Whether caused by heavy furniture, high heels, or even accidental drops, dents can ruin the aesthetic appeal of your flooring. Fortunately, there are effective methods to remedy this issue, allowing you to restore your floor without the need for professional help.
To start with, identifying the type of dent in your wooden floor is crucial. Dents can be categorized into two types: shallow and deep. Shallow dents are often surface-level impressions that can be fixed relatively easily. Deep dents may require a more intensive approach, possibly involving the removal of planks or sanding. One of the most popular methods to fix shallow dents is the use of steam. This technique works by utilizing the moisture and heat to swell the wood fibers back to their original position. To do this, you can use a damp cloth and an iron. Place the damp cloth over the dent and then run a hot iron over it for a few seconds. The heat and steam will help lift the dent. Another effective method for fixing dents is through the use of wood filler. This is particularly useful for deeper dents where the wood has been significantly compressed. You can purchase wood filler that matches the color of your floor. Start by cleaning the area around the dent, then apply the wood filler with a putty knife, ensuring it is level with the surrounding floor. Once it dries, sand it lightly to achieve a smooth finish. If you prefer a more natural approach, you might consider using ice cubes to fix the dent. This unconventional method is particularly effective for smaller dents. Simply place an ice cube in the dent and let it melt. As the ice melts, the water will seep into the wood, causing it to swell back into its original shape. After the area dries, you can buff it with a cloth to restore its original shine. This method is not only eco-friendly but also budget-friendly.

It’s important to note that prevention plays a key role in maintaining the integrity of your wooden floor. Using furniture pads under heavy items can help prevent future dents. Regular cleaning and maintenance can also help avoid scratches and other forms of damage. Additionally, placing rugs in high-traffic areas can minimize the risk of dents and other unsightly marks.
